Grass

Grass provides developers with a dedicated virtual machine (VM) that is always ready to execute code, allowing users to seamlessly code from their phone or any device. This solution addresses the common challenge of limited access to reliable and responsive coding environments, particularly for those on the go or without access to a personal computer. Grass is ideal for mobile developers, tech enthusiasts, and remote workers who need a flexible, on-demand coding setup that enhances productivity and fosters creativity, no matter where they are.

Key Features

1

Cross-Device Code Execution

Users can write and execute code seamlessly from any device, including smartphones and tablets, ensuring they can work from anywhere without being tied to a personal computer.

2

Always-On Virtual Machine

Grass offers a dedicated virtual machine that is always ready to run code, eliminating the need for users to set up or wait for a coding environment to become available.

3

User-Friendly Interface

The platform provides an intuitive interface designed for mobile use, allowing users to easily navigate and manage their coding projects on smaller screens.

4

Real-Time Collaboration

Users can collaborate with other developers in real-time, sharing code and receiving instant feedback, which enhances teamwork and productivity.

5

Integrated Development Tools

Grass includes built-in development tools and libraries, enabling users to code efficiently without the need to install additional software or dependencies.

6

Code Versioning and History

Users can track changes to their code with version control features, allowing them to revert to previous versions and manage their codebase effectively.

7

Customizable Environments

Developers can customize their virtual machine settings, including language preferences and resource allocation, to suit their specific coding needs.

8

Offline Coding Capabilities

Grass allows users to download their coding environment for offline use, enabling them to continue working without an internet connection.
